Transaction 4bd76850624232a070e190a86ed7ff741938eb322566589174793a2d7a3f0b6e
1 Input
1 Output
-
4bd76850624232a070e190a86ed7ff741938eb322566589174793a2d7a3f0b6e:0
- value
- 5245933
- script pubkey
- OP_0 OP_PUSHBYTES_20 e59aab316fa60b1f5de0fb1569c9f885b2a82e8d
- address
- bc1qukd2kvt05c937h0qlv2knj0cske2st5dmlu2rh